You know the operational burden: 3,000+ config knobs, JVM tuning, shard calculators, master election storms, and a team of specialists to keep it running. XERJ is a drop-in replacement — same API on port 9200, same query DSL, same client libraries — at a fraction of the resource cost.

RESOURCE COMPARISON · XERJ vs ES 8.13 (4-NODE)
XERJ ES 8.13 (4-NODE)
Idle memory 400 MB 8.5 GB 21.3×
Disk (1M SIEM) 1.1 GB 3.1 GB 2.8×
Cold start 50 ms 15 s 300.0×
Config knobs 47 3,000+ 63.8×
Binaries to run 1 5 5.0×
